Sherwood Forest Bingo! Ranger Edition - Call List

(Print) Use this randomly generated list as your call list when playing the game. There is no need to say the BINGO column name. Place some kind of mark (like an X, a checkmark, a dot, tally mark, etc) on each cell as you announce it, to keep track. You can also cut out each item, place them in a bag and pull words from the bag.

  1. Walk silently for a whole minute (ninja mode)
  2. Track something ridiculous (fair food, a band, your rogue)
  3. Say “I don’t trust it” about something perfectly normal
  4. Pretend your drink is a potion made from herbs you foraged
  5. Do the ranger squint: narrowed eyes, chin tilt, deep nod
  6. Declare someone your sworn quarry (playfully!)
  7. Lead your party like a trail guide
  8. Talk to an animal like you’re expecting a reply
  9. Stand alone in a crowd like you're watching for danger
  10. Climb something for “tactical advantage”
  11. Point dramatically into the distance and say “Tracks… fresh ones.”
  12. Give directions using only vague natural landmarks
  13. Talk about “the wilds” like you grew up there
  14. Identify a bird or pretend to
  15. Set a “trap” (stick + string, or just a leaf with a sign)
  16. Blend into your surroundings (bonus if it’s just standing near a plant)
  17. Make a dramatic entrance from behind a tree
  18. Pretend to scout ahead and report back
  19. Share a memory that “still haunts you”
  20. Give someone a ranger name like “Ash Whisperwind”
  21. Use a walking stick as a “ranger’s bow” or staff
  22. Make up a backstory for your ranger companion (animal or otherwise)
  23. Spot someone from your party before they see you
  24. Share survival tips no one asked for
